Actually it is the lack of a second processor in the AP2.0 unit that prevents recording videos. (Sentry/dashcam works just fine with MCU1/AP2.5.) Though MCU2 is required to record the rear video feed.
I think sentry mode has been in the media enough that it's known outside of just owners. I believe it is the lack of codecs on the AP2 computer that prevent it recording video and as mentioned on MCU1 that prevent recording the rear camera.
There is a point to sentry mode on AP2 however and that is not confirming that you can't record video. It may not help the owner by providing video of an event, but the flashing lights and claim of video recording might discourage some people. It also apparently has the effect of keeping switched 12V online, which lets people with dashcams that aren't wired for parking mode record while parked.
